COVID-19: Containment measures, activities, advisories

The state government departments and district administrations have issued various advisories for the public and government employees in order to contain the spread of COVID-19. Vaccination drives are also being consistently undertaken, in order to ensure that all the citizens stay protected. 

Special vaccination drive in Kiphire: Special vaccination drive on COVID-19 vaccine commenced at Government Higher Secondary School Kiphire.
On the first day of vaccination, 91 beneficiaries of 45 years and above and 19 beneficiaries of 18 years and above received the jab.
The vaccination drive was also continued in other towns in the district. Along with medical staffs, members from district task force Kiphire, district administration, USLP, ESH, student leaders and women organisation assisted in the special drive. 
Meanwhile, political leaders, tribal leaders and church leaders also took the initiative to share awareness video clips on social media to educate the people on the advantages and benefits of getting the vaccine. (Correspondent)
DTF Longleng organises sensitisation campaign: District Task Force, Longleng lead by the district administration, police, medical department and village guard organised a sensitisation campaign on June 8, at Yongnyah & Namsang Area under Tamlu Sub-division of Longleng.
Vaccination drive, formation of Village Task Force and Community Care Centre was carried out as part of the sensitisation program.
Kazheto Kinimi visits Akuluto: Advisor NSDMA and CAWD, Kazheto Kinimi visited Akuluto on June 6 and interacted with SDTF Akuluto, Zunheboto, regarding its preparedness against COVID-19 pandemic under its jurisdiction. 
According to DIPR, the advisor assured the SDTF of TrueNat testing facility and oxygen concentrators at Akuluto PHC at the nearest possible time. 
Kazheto also provided assistance to SDTF and made an appeal to remain sincere in the fight against the pandemic.
DC Wokha issues advisory: Deputy Commissioner & Chairman District Task Force for COVID-19 Wokha, Orenthung Lotha has informed that in view of the detection of COVID-19 positive case at SBI main branch, Wokha, all customers who have visited the bank with effect from June 4 have been advised remain home quarantined for 10 days with self monitoring of their health by wearing mask, social distancing and frequently hand washing.
During the quarantine period, should any of the symptoms, fever, cough and difficulty in breathing develops, DC has requested them to isolate and contact the district helpline numbers at 9863663885 (war room) and 70859885597 or 7628832000 (district hospital) for any assistance and information.
Vaccination to be held Peren town hall: ADC of Peren, K. Mhathung Tsanglao has notified that due to various difficulties at the present vaccination site at district hospital, Peren, the ongoing vaccination for COVID-19 would be temporarily carried out at Town Hall, Peren Town from June 8 till July 8. 
Meanwhile, the ADC also notified that the intensified vaccination drive from June 8-18 for all eligible beneficiaries of 18-44 years and 45 years and above, on-site registration and vaccination would be carried out in all the wards under Peren town as per the scheduled listed: June 10; team I would be ward no 3- Ndining, dressing room, Local Ground; team II; ward no 4- Duiring, chairman’s residence, On June 11: team I; ward no 5- Nsetning, Anganwadi Centre, team II; ward no 6- Mdipuiram, chairman’s residence; June 12: team I; ward no 7- Beilikui, ward council hall; team II; ward no 8- Bana, Ban GPS, June 14: team I; ward no 9- Nkozai, ward council secretary’s residence.
The ADC has also requested differently abled people to contact health workers in their respective areas for special priority for vaccination. All the ward chairmen have been asked to mobilise their respective Ward Task Force to extend all possible assistance for smooth conduct of the vaccination drive. The beneficiaries have also been requested to maintain COVID-19 appropriate behaviour.
House sealed at Aboi: In order to take effective measures to prevent the spread of COVID-19, ADC Aboi, Chumlamo Humstoe has ordered the sealing of a house at Khendinyu field, Ngangching Village with boundaries as follows: North: Block Institute of Teachers Education (BITC); East: Border Roads; West: Forest; South: Khendinyu. The ADC has informed that the house was to remain sealed till further orders. Any person violating the containment measures would be liable to be proceeded against as per the provision of Sections 51 to 60 of Disaster Management Act 2005 besides legal action under IPC Section 188 and other legal provisions as applicable.
